Meus Projetos
Projeto: Blog Pessoal 📝
- No meu projeto de blog pessoal, desenvolvi a parte do back-end, criando CRUDs para gerenciar usuários, postagens e temas. A aplicação permite o login de usuários, com verificação de senha realizada por Spring Security, garantindo a segurança no acesso às informações.
- Utilizando Java e Spring, implementei a lógica de negócio e a comunicação com o PostgreSQL, realizando o gerenciamento dos dados e a interação com a API por meio do Swagger. O foco principal foi construir uma estrutura robusta e segura para que os dados fossem bem organizados e facilmente acessíveis.
- Atualmente, o projeto encontra-se em fase de desenvolvimento, com a parte do back-end já consolidada. Os próximos passos envolvem a implementação do front-end com React, JavaScript, HTML e CSS, buscando integrar a interface de forma dinâmica e responsiva, proporcionando uma experiência completa para os usuários. Este projeto faz parte da minha formação na Generation Brasil, onde estou aprendendo e aplicando conhecimentos para me tornar um profissional mais completo.
Projeto Integrador: Aplicação de Restaurantes 🍽️
- Este é um projeto integrador desenvolvido em grupo como parte da formação na Generation Brasil, com o objetivo de criar uma plataforma onde restaurantes podem se cadastrar, divulgar seus cardápios, fornecer informações sobre localização, preços e exibir fotos dos seus produtos. A aplicação oferece funcionalidades essenciais para gerenciar restaurantes, produtos e categorias, além de um método GET especial para localizar produtos saudáveis, facilitando a escolha dos clientes.
- Utilizando Java, Spring Boot, MySQL e Spring Security, implementamos a lógica de negócios e segurança do sistema, garantindo a proteção dos dados dos usuários e um fluxo de trabalho eficiente.
- A interface, que ainda está em desenvolvimento, será construída com HTML5, CSS3 e JavaScript, com React planejado para o futuro, visando oferecer uma experiência interativa e dinâmica aos usuários.
Projeto: Site Currículo 💼
- Este projeto visa criar um site estático que serve como um currículo online. O site foi desenvolvido para apresentar minhas habilidades, experiência profissional e projetos, de forma simples e direta, para potenciais empregadores ou colaboradores.
- O site foi desenvolvido utilizando HTML5 e CSS3 para garantir uma estrutura sólida e estilização eficiente. Para o layout, foram aplicadas técnicas de Grid e Flexbox, proporcionando uma organização fluida e responsiva. A hospedagem do projeto foi realizada no GitHub Pages, garantindo acessibilidade e facilidade de acesso ao site.
- Este site, que você está acessando agora, é o próprio projeto mencionado. Ele será atualizado com novos conteúdos e informações conforme minha trajetória profissional evolui.
Projeto: Meu Perfil 👤
- Desenvolvi um site pessoal para apresentar meu perfil profissional de forma interativa. O projeto conta com uma estrutura responsiva e validação de formulário, garantindo uma melhor experiência para o usuário. Caso o e-mail não possua @ ou o nome e o assunto não tenham os caracteres necessários, o sistema retorna uma mensagem amigável informando o erro.
- Para a construção do site, utilizei HTML, CSS e JavaScript, aplicando conceitos de desenvolvimento web, responsividade e validação de formulários. Além disso, realizei o deploy do projeto no GitHub Pages, tornando-o acessível online.
- Confira o projeto no link abaixo: